Revenue at Weaccess Group has contracted by 1.0% per year over the past 13 years to 1.04 M EUR. Earnings per share have grown at 1.4% per year over the last 8 years. Weaccess Group's net margin stands at -18.3%, down from 8.2% several years earlier. The stock trades about 484% above its 52-week low.

Total Return vs. Price Return

The "Total Return" toggle includes reinvested dividends on top of the pure price movement. This is critical because dividends can account for a significant portion of long-term returns. Historically, roughly 40 % of the S&P 500's total return has come from dividends. Always compare total return when evaluating a stock's real performance against a benchmark.

Income Statement Key Figures

Revenue and Revenue Growth

Revenue is the starting point of every income statement — it measures the total sales Weaccess Group generates from its core business. Revenue growth (expressed as year-over-year percentage change) is one of the most important indicators of business momentum. Sustained growth above 10 % annually is generally considered strong, while declining revenue is a serious warning sign that demands investigation.

Gross Margin

Gross margin = (Revenue − Cost of Goods Sold) ÷ Revenue. It reveals what percentage of each dollar of revenue Weaccess Group retains after direct production costs. High gross margins (above 50 %) are typical of asset-light businesses like software and brands, while capital-intensive industries like manufacturing often operate below 30 %. Compare Weaccess Group's gross margin to industry peers and track it over time to spot improving or deteriorating pricing power.

EBIT and EBIT Margin

EBIT measures operating profit — what remains after subtracting all operating expenses (including R&D, sales, and administrative costs) from gross profit. The EBIT margin shows this as a percentage of revenue. Because it excludes interest and taxes, EBIT allows fair comparisons between companies with different debt levels and tax jurisdictions. A rising EBIT margin indicates improving operational efficiency.

Net Income and Earnings Per Share (EPS)

Net income is the company's final profit after all expenses, interest, and taxes. Dividing net income by the number of shares outstanding gives you EPS — the single most influential metric in stock valuation. Consistent EPS growth is the primary driver of long-term stock price appreciation. Always check whether EPS growth comes from genuine profit improvement or from share buybacks reducing the share count.

Shares Outstanding

The total number of shares Weaccess Group has issued. A declining share count (through buybacks) boosts EPS and signals management confidence. A rising share count (through stock issuance) dilutes existing shareholders. Always monitor this number alongside EPS to get the full picture of per-share value creation.

Weaccess Group business model & stock analysis

The Weaccess Group SA is an international company that offers various solutions in the field of Information Technology (IT). The company was founded in Switzerland in 2005 and is headquartered in Rolle. Since its establishment, the Weaccess Group SA has become an important provider of IT solutions on a national and international level. The Weaccess Group SA focuses on the business of digital identities and security solutions. With its products and services, the company supports businesses in ensuring data security and provides the foundation for a secure digital identity. An important area of the Weaccess Group SA is project and product management. The company offers its customers various software and hardware solutions, as well as a large and experienced team of consultants to ensure optimal and customer-oriented implementation. Another important pillar of the Weaccess Group SA is cloud computing. The company offers cloud services that allow customers to store and access data and applications at the highest level of security in the cloud. The cloud solutions offer high flexibility and scalability, and are particularly powerful and secure. The Weaccess Group SA has also developed special digitalization solutions to support customers in digitizing their business processes. This allows businesses to automate their workflows and achieve significant efficiency gains. By using digitalization solutions, businesses can quickly respond to market changes and gain a competitive advantage. Another important sector of the Weaccess Group SA is telecommunications. The company offers comprehensive telecommunications solutions that enable high-quality communication between employees and customers. These solutions encompass both hardware and software. The Weaccess Group SA aims to support its customers with innovative and efficient solutions and provide added value. The company relies on state-of-the-art technologies to comprehensively and sustainably support customers in the IT sector.

What Is Fair Value?

Fair value is an estimate of what a stock is truly "worth" based on its financial fundamentals, independent of the current market price. If the calculated fair value is above the current share price, the stock may be undervalued — and vice versa. This chart shows three different fair value approaches so you can cross-check them against each other.

Earnings-Based Fair Value

Calculated by multiplying the current earnings per share (EPS) by the average historical P/E ratio over a selected multi-year period. The smoothing over several years filters out temporary spikes or dips. If this fair value exceeds the market price, it suggests the stock is cheap relative to its earning power.

Example: Fair Value (Earnings) 2022 = EPS 2022 × Average P/E 2019–2021

Revenue-Based Fair Value

Derived by multiplying revenue per share by the average historical price-to-sales ratio. This method is particularly useful for companies with volatile or temporarily depressed earnings, as revenue tends to be more stable than profits. It answers: "At what price has the market historically valued each dollar of this company's sales?"

Example: Fair Value (Revenue) 2022 = Revenue per Share 2022 × Average P/S 2019–2021

Dividend-Based Fair Value

Calculated by dividing the dividend per share by the average historical dividend yield. This approach is most relevant for mature, consistently dividend-paying companies. If the resulting fair value is higher than the current price, it implies the stock offers a better yield than its historical average.

Example: Fair Value (Dividend) 2022 = Dividend per Share 2022 ÷ Average Yield 2019–2021

How to Use This Chart

When all three fair value lines converge above the current price, it strengthens the case that the stock is undervalued. When they diverge, investigate why — it may indicate a structural shift in margins, payout policy, or growth rate. The forward estimates on the right extend the analysis using projected fundamentals, helping you assess whether the current price already reflects future growth expectations.
